All Downloads are FREE. Search and download functionalities are using the official Maven repository.

it.cnr.contab.bollo00.bulk.V_cons_atto_bolloBulkPersistentInfo.xml Maven / Gradle / Ivy

<?xml version="1.0" encoding="UTF-8"?>
<!--
  ~ Copyright (C) 2019  Consiglio Nazionale delle Ricerche
  ~
  ~     This program is free software: you can redistribute it and/or modify
  ~     it under the terms of the GNU Affero General Public License as
  ~     published by the Free Software Foundation, either version 3 of the
  ~     License, or (at your option) any later version.
  ~
  ~     This program is distributed in the hope that it will be useful,
  ~     but WITHOUT ANY WARRANTY; without even the implied warranty of
  ~     M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
  ~     GNU Affero General Public License for more details.
  ~
  ~     You should have received a copy of the GNU Affero General Public License
  ~     along with this program.  If not, see <https://www.gnu.org/licenses/>.
  -->

<SQLPersistentInfo
	persistentClassName="it.cnr.contab.bollo00.bulk.V_cons_atto_bolloBulk"
	homeClassName="it.cnr.contab.bollo00.bulk.V_cons_atto_bolloHome">
	<defaultColumnMap
		tableName="V_CONS_ATTO_BOLLO">
		<columnMapping
			columnName="ESERCIZIO"
			propertyName="esercizio"
			sqlTypeName="DECIMAL"
			columnSize="4" />
		<columnMapping
			columnName="DESCRIZIONE_ATTO"
			propertyName="descrizioneAtto"
			sqlTypeName="VARCHAR"
			columnSize="300" />
		<columnMapping
			columnName="CD_UNITA_ORGANIZZATIVA"
			propertyName="cdU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="30" />
		<columnMapping
			columnName="DS_UNITA_ORGANIZZATIVA"
			propertyName="dsU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="300" />
		<columnMapping
			columnName="CD_TIPO_ATTO"
			propertyName="cdT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="3" />
		<columnMapping
			columnName="DS_TIPO_ATTO"
			propertyName="dsT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="1000" />
		<columnMapping
			columnName="RIFERIMENTO"
			propertyName="riferimento"
			sqlTypeName="VARCHAR"
			columnSize="100" />			
		<columnMapping
			columnName="TI_DETTAGLI"
			propertyName="tiDettagli"
			sqlTypeName="CHAR"
			columnSize="1" />
		<columnMapping
			columnName="NUM_DETTAGLI"
			propertyName="numDettagli"
			sqlTypeName="DECIMAL"
			columnSize="6" />
		<columnMapping
			columnName="IM_BOLLO"
			propertyName="imBollo"
			sqlTypeName="DECIMAL"
			columnSize="15"
			columnScale="2" />
		<columnMapping
			columnName="IM_TOTALE_BOLLO"
			propertyName="imTotaleBollo"
			sqlTypeName="DECIMAL"
			columnSize="15"
			columnScale="2" />
	</defaultColumnMap>

	<persistentProperty
		name="esercizio" />
	<persistentProperty
		name="descrizioneAtto" />
	<persistentProperty
		name="cdUnitaOrganizzativa" />
	<persistentProperty
		name="dsUnitaOrganizzativa" />
	<persistentProperty
		name="cdTipoAtto" />
	<persistentProperty
		name="dsTipoAtto" />
	<persistentProperty
		name="riferimento" />	
	<persistentProperty
		name="tiDettagli" />	
	<persistentProperty
		name="numDettagli" />	
	<persistentProperty
		name="imBollo" />	
	<persistentProperty
		name="imTotaleBollo" />
		
    <columnMap
            name="BASE"
            tableName="V_CONS_ATTO_BOLLO">
		<columnMapping
			columnName="ESERCIZIO"
			propertyName="esercizio"
			sqlTypeName="DECIMAL"
			columnSize="4" />
		<columnMapping
			columnName="IM_TOTALE_BOLLO"
			propertyName="imTotaleBollo"
			sqlTypeName="DECIMAL"
			columnSize="15"
			columnScale="2" />
	</columnMap>

    <columnMap
            name="BASETIP"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ASE" >
		<columnMapping
			columnName="CD_TIPO_ATTO"
			propertyName="cdT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="3" />
		<columnMapping
			columnName="IM_BOLLO"
			propertyName="imBollo"
			sqlTypeName="DECIMAL"
			columnSize="15"
			columnScale="2" />
		<columnMapping
			columnName="TI_DETTAGLI"
			propertyName="tiDettagli"
			sqlTypeName="CHAR"
			columnSize="1" />
		<columnMapping
			columnName="NUM_DETTAGLI"
			propertyName="numDettagli"
			sqlTypeName="DECIMAL"
			columnSize="6" />
	</columnMap>

    <columnMap
            name="BASETIPUO"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ASETIP" >
		<columnMapping
			columnName="CD_UNITA_ORGANIZZATIVA"
			propertyName="cdU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="30" />
	</columnMap>

    <columnMap
            name="BASEUO"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ASE" >
		<columnMapping
			columnName="CD_UNITA_ORGANIZZATIVA"
			propertyName="cdU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="30" />            
	</columnMap>
	
    <columnMap
            name="BASEUOTIP"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ASEUO" >
		<columnMapping
			columnName="CD_TIPO_ATTO"
			propertyName="cdT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="3" />
		<columnMapping
			columnName="IM_BOLLO"
			propertyName="imBollo"
			sqlTypeName="DECIMAL"
			columnSize="15"
			columnScale="2" />
		<columnMapping
			columnName="TI_DETTAGLI"
			propertyName="tiDettagli"
			sqlTypeName="CHAR"
			columnSize="1" />
		<columnMapping
			columnName="NUM_DETTAGLI"
			propertyName="numDettagli"
			sqlTypeName="DECIMAL"
			columnSize="6" />
	</columnMap>

    <columnMap
            name="TIP"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ASETIP">
		<columnMapping
			columnName="DS_TIPO_ATTO"
			propertyName="dsT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="1000" />
	</columnMap>
	
    <columnMap
            name="TIPUO"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ASETIPUO" >
		<columnMapping
			columnName="DS_UNITA_ORGANIZZATIVA"
			propertyName="dsU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="300" />
	</columnMap>	

    <columnMap
            name="TIPUODET"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ASETIPUO" >
		<columnMapping
			columnName="DESCRIZIONE_ATTO"
			propertyName="descrizioneAtto"
			sqlTypeName="VARCHAR"
			columnSize="300" />
		<columnMapping
			columnName="RIFERIMENTO"
			propertyName="riferimento"
			sqlTypeName="VARCHAR"
			columnSize="100" />	
	</columnMap>
	
	<columnMap
            name="UO"
            tableName="V_CONS_ATTO_BOLLO" 
            extends="BASEUO">
		<columnMapping
			columnName="DS_UNITA_ORGANIZZATIVA"
			propertyName="dsUnitaOrganizzativa"
			sqlTypeName="VARCHAR"
			columnSize="300" />
	</columnMap>	
	
	<columnMap
            name="UOTIP"
            tableName="V_CONS_ATTO_BOLLO"
            extends="BASEUOTIP" >
		<columnMapping
			columnName="DS_TIPO_ATTO"
			propertyName="dsTipoAtto"
			sqlTypeName="VARCHAR"
			columnSize="1000" />
	</columnMap>	

    <columnMap
            name="UOTIPDET"
            tableName="V_CONS_ATTO_BOLLO"
            extends="TIPUODET" >
	</columnMap>	
</SQLPersistentInfo>




© 2015 - 2025 Weber Informatics LLC | Privacy Policy